The transcript discusses economic challenges faced by the Fed and ECB, with a focus on BlackRock's strategy in response to repo market volatility. It emphasizes the importance of building portfolio resilience through diversification, particularly in gold and government bonds. The discussion also highlights a preference for European government bonds due to potential ECB actions and the benefits of holding U.S. government bonds despite yield compression.
